### 2024-W19 — Key rotation, autocomplete index

While investigating the slow autocomplete index in Findwell (p95 lookups above 900ms after the shard split), we discovered the index rebuild job was signing artifacts with the retired key, causing silent retries. We have rotated the key and re-signed all pending index segments; rebuild latency is back under target. The replacement signing key follows below.

deploy key for kajof-fajop: bky6_gDHw9Q

Action item from the Driftwarden incident: the orphaned-resource sweeper deleted volumes that were detached but still referenced by a paused job. Fix is to add a grace-period check against the job registry before deletion — that's the PR you're reviewing. Please pay extra attention to the dry-run path; last time it diverged from the real path and we missed this class of bug. Expected sweeper behavior and edge cases are spelled out on the internal page below.

wiki page, tahaf-tajog: https://jira.ordindyn.corp/pipeline

Facilities Ticket — Night Access, Support Team

New starters on Quillon Support: night-shift access to the Ashmere Annexe is now live. Main doors lock at 20:00. Use the side entrance by the loading bay. Badge readers are offline until the upgrade finishes, so use the keypad instead. Report faults to the duty supervisor. Keypad code follows below.

badge for kageg-fajog: bdg-FNNRG-32288

Subject: Handover — validator plugin stuff

Hey Priya,

Passing you the baton on Checkwright, our plugin system for data validators. The new schema-drift plugin shipped Tuesday and mostly behaves, but it occasionally flags empty CSV uploads as "malformed" — harmless, just noisy. I've muted the alert until Friday. If support escalates anything about plugin load failures, the fix is usually bumping the registry cache. Questions after I'm off? Reach the Checkwright maintainers at the address below.

billing contact of hawip-kahif = zorwyn@tolvaqlabs.corp